Now Hiring: Assistant Event Coordinator at The Historic Eagle House

California, Humboldt county, 95511 Humboldt county USA
Aplica ya

Location: Old Town Eureka, CA | Part-Time

The Historic Eagle House is a historic and vibrant hospitality venue located in the heart of Old Town Eureka. With our boutique inn, beloved cocktail lounge, Phatsy Kline’s, and a variety of stunning event spaces—including our grand ballroom—we host everything from weddings and family gatherings to concerts, community mixers, retreats, and private parties.

We are seeking a passionate, organized, and service-oriented Assistant Event Coordinator to join our Events Team. If you love connecting with people, multitasking with grace, bringing in new guests and clients and helping to bring unforgettable experiences to life, we’d love to meet you!

Position: Assistant Event Coordinator

Key Responsibilities:

Monitor and respond to event intake forms and inquiries

Support Event Manager in all phases of event planning and execution

Communicate clearly and professionally with clients and vendors

Attend and assist with on-site events, serving as event lead when needed

Maintain and update task sheets, contracts, timelines, and communications

Perform outreach to past and potential clients for bookings

Call clients 2+ weeks prior to events to confirm details

Coordinate with team leads, vendors, and staff to ensure seamless execution

Ensure proper set-up, takedown, and cleanup of events

Manage event inventory and rentals

Follow up after events with thank-you notes and feedback requests

Help promote public events via social media and event calendars

Support with booking concerts and public programming

Qualifications:

High school diploma or equivalent required

Excellent organizational and communication skills

Strong attention to detail and follow-through

Ability to lead and work collaboratively as part of a team

Experience in event coordination, customer service, or hospitality preferred

Proficiency with basic computer software (email, Google Drive, POS systems)

Flexible availability, including weekends and evenings

Comfortable working long hours on your feet and lifting up to 50 lbs

ABC Responsible Beverage Service (RBS) and Food Handler certifications (or willingness to obtain)

Bonus if you have:

Social media or marketing experience

Knowledge of local venues, vendors, and hospitality networks

A calm, solution-oriented approach under pressure

A love for music, events, and community building!
